William Rankine, an engineer and physicist, established an alternative to Coulomb's earth pressure theory. Albert Atterberg created the clay uniformity indices that are still made use of today for soil classification. In 1885, Osborne Reynolds recognized that shearing causes volumetric dilation of dense products and tightening of loose granular materials. Modern geotechnical engineering is said to have begun in 1925 with the magazine of Erdbaumechanik by Karl von Terzaghi, a mechanical engineer and geologist. Terzaghi also created the structure for theories of birthing capability of structures, and the concept for forecast of the rate of negotiation of clay layers as a result of consolidation. Afterwards, Maurice Biot completely established the three-dimensional soil combination concept, expanding the one-dimensional model previously developed by Terzaghi to a lot more general theories and introducing the collection of basic formulas of Poroelasticity.
Geotechnical engineers check out and determine the properties of subsurface problems and products. They likewise make equivalent earthworks and maintaining structures, passages, and structure foundations, and may monitor and review websites, which may even more include website surveillance along with the risk analysis and mitigation of all-natural risks. Geotechnical engineers and design geologists execute geotechnical examinations to obtain information on the physical properties of soil and rock underlying and surrounding to a website to make earthworks and structures for recommended structures and for the repair work of distress to earthworks and structures brought on by subsurface conditions.

If the user interface in between the mass and the base of a slope has a complex geometry, slope security evaluation is tough and mathematical service methods are needed. Typically, the user interface's precise geometry is unknown, and a simplified user interface geometry is presumed. Finite slopes call for three-dimensional designs to be analyzed, so most inclines are analyzed presuming that they are infinitely vast and can be represented by two-dimensional models.
